Meanwhile you made very nice progress!
I looked into the
7e8dfb474 Work around nyacc #define parsing/evaluation bug.
problem and found that this
--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
#define HAVE_FOO 0x1
int
main ()
{
#if HAVE_FOO
return 0;
#endif
return 1;
}
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---
does not work, however using `#define HAVE_FOO 1' works.
I bisected Nyacc and found the problem to be Mes' string->number:
(string->number "#x1") => #f
I have added a fix for this and reverted the workaround.
